Dr. Olds is an Associate Professor in the Guggenheim School of Aerospace Engineering at the Georgia Institute of Technology. As Co-Director of Georgia Tech's Space Systems Design Laboratory, he leads a research program focused on conceptual design and technology assessment of advanced space transportation systems. He is responsible for undergraduate and graduate level instruction in the areas of space systems design, multidisciplinary optimization and space propulsion. Prior to coming to Georgia Tech, Dr. Olds worked at General Dynamics Space Systems Division and completed assignments at the NASA Langley Research Center and NASA Marshall Space Flight Center. Dr. Olds also served as a visiting assistant professor at North Carolina State University. He is founder of an Atlanta-based aerospace engineering consulting firm, SpaceWorks Engineering, Inc., and is a registered professional engineer in the State of Georgia.
